Risk of Personal Injury and Property Damage
Do not apply power to the system before checking all
wiring connections. Short circuited or improperly con-
nected wires may result in permanent damage to the
equipment.

Important: Do not exceed the controller electrical
ratings. Exceeding controller electrical ratings can
result in permanent damage to the controller and
void any warranty.
Important: Use copper conductors only. Make
all wiring in accordance with local, national, and
regional regulations.
Important: Electrostatic discharge can damage
controller components. Use proper electrostatic
discharge precautions during installation, setup, and
servicing to avoid damaging the controller.

Terminal blocks and bus ports
See Figure 1 for terminal block and bus port locations
on the IOM controller. Observe the following guidelines
when wiring an IOM controller.
Input and Output terminal blocks
All of the input terminal blocks are mounted on the
bottom of the controller and the output terminal blocks
are mounted on the top of the controller. See Table
2 for more information about I/O terminal functions,
requirements, and ratings.
SA/FC bus terminal block
An IOM can be connected to a SA bus or a FC bus, but not
to both buses simultaneously. The SA/FC bus terminal
block is a removable, 4-terminal plug that fits into a
board-mounted jack.
When connecting the IOM to an FC bus, wire the bus
terminal block plugs on the controller, and the other
controllers in a daisy-chain configuration using 3-wire

When connecting the IOM to an SA bus, wire the bus
terminal block plugs on the controller and other SA
bus devices in a daisy-chain configuration using 4-wire
twisted, shielded cable as shown in Figure 5. See

Note: The SA PWR/SHLD terminal does not supply 15
VDC. The SA PWR/SHLD terminal is isolated and can
be used to connect (daisy chain) the 15 VDC power
leads on the SA bus (Figure 5) or the cable shields
on the FC bus (Figure 4). The SA bus supervisor (FAC,
FEC, or VMA) supplies 15 VDC to devices on the SA
bus requiring power.
